A Single-Arm, Multicenter, Exploratory Clinical Study on the Efficacy and Safety of AK112 in Perioperative Treatment of Resectable Hepatocellular Carcinoma With High Recurrence Risk

研究概览

简要总结

This study is a single-arm, open-label study. To assess the efficacy and safety of AK112 therapy in patients with resectable hepatocellular carcinoma at high risk of recurrence. The primary endpoint is the 12-month RFS rate of resectable hepatocellular carcinoma.

入选标准

  • Signed written informed consent before any trial-related procedures.
  • Male or female aged between 18 and 75 years.
  • ECOG PS score 0-
  • Histologically/cytologically confirmed h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) or meets clinical diagnosis criteria (per 2022 Chinese Primary Liver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ment Guidelines).
  • No preoperative HCC treatment (including chemotherapy, targeted therapy, immunotherapy, cell therapy, local radiotherapy, ablation, or intervention). No lymph node invasion/distant metastasis on preoperative imaging, and deemed suitable for radical surgery by the investigator.
  • At least one postoperative high-risk factor for HCC recurrence:
  • Single lesion more than 5 cm in longest diameter.
  • Microvascular or macrovascular invasion.
  • More than 3 tumor nodules.
  • Edmondson grade at least II on tumor pathology.
  • AFP more than 400 μg/L in CNLC Ib-IIa patients.
  • Tumor adjacent to blood vessels in CNLC Ib-IIa patients.
  • Incomplete tumor capsule in CNLC Ib-IIa patients.
  • Child-Pugh score A or B
  • Expected survival more than 3 months.
  • At least one measurable lesion per RECIST 1.
  • Total T3 or free T3 and free T4 within normal range (thyroid replacement therapy allowed). Asymptomatic subjects with abnormal T3, free T3, or free T4 are eligible.
  • Adequate organ and bone marrow function, with laboratory values meeting the following criteria within 7 days before randomization (no blood products, growth factors, albumin, or corrective treatments within 14 days before obtaining these results):
  • Hematology: ANC at least 1.5×10⁹/L; PLT at least 75×10⁹/L; HGB at least 9.0 g/dL.
  • Liver function: TBIL at most 3×ULN; ALT, AST, ALP at most 5×ULN; serum albumin at least 28 g/L.
  • Renal function: Serum creatinine at most 1.5×ULN or CCr at least 50 mL/min (Cockcroft-Gault formula); urine protein less than 2+ on urinalysis. For subjects with baseline urine protein at least 2+, 24-hour urine protein less than 1 g.
  • Coagulation: INR and APTT at most 1.5×ULN.
  • For female subjects of childbearing potential, a negative urine or serum pregnancy test within 3 days before the first study drug administration (Cycle 1, Day 1). If urine test is inconclusive, a blood pregnancy test is required. Postmenopausal females (for at least 1 year), surgically sterilized, or hysterectomized are not of childbearing potential.
  • All subjects with pregnancy risk must use effective contraception throughout treatment until 120 days after the last study drug dose (or 180 days after last chemotherapy dose).

排除标准

  • Past histological/cytological diagnosis of fibrolamellar h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C), sarcomatoid HCC, cholangiocarcinoma, etc.
  • Other malignancies within 5 years before enrollment, except those locally treated HCC. Exceptions include basal/squamous cell skin cancer, superficial bladder cancer, cervical/ breast carcinoma in situ.
  • History of hepatic encephalopathy or liver transplantation.
  • Cancer thrombus in portal vein branches, superior mesenteric vein, or inferior vena cava.
  • Active hepatitis B/C infection, with HBV DNA more than 2000 IU/ml or 10⁴ copies/ml; HCV RNA more than 10³ copies/ml; co-positive HBsAg and anti-HCV. Those on antiviral therapy meeting the above criteria and willing to continue during the study are eligible.
  • Clinically symptomatic pleural effusion, ascites, or pericardial effusion requiring drainage.
  • Esophagogastric variceal bleeding due to portal hypertension within 6 months before first dose; current imaging shows significant esophagogastric varices.
  • History of significant bleeding tendency/coagulopathy; clinically significant bleeding within 1 month before first dose (e.g., GI bleeding, hemoptysis, epistaxis); continuous antiplatelet/anticoagulant therapy within 10 days before first dose.
  • Arterial/venous thromboembolism within past 6 months, including myocardial infarction, unstable angina, stroke, transient ischemic attack, pulmonary embolism, deep vein thrombosis. Exceptions: stable thrombosis after routine anticoagulation for implanted venous ports/ catheters or superficial vein thrombosis; low-dose LMWH (e.g., enoxaparin 40 mg/day) allowed.
  • History of myocarditis, cardiomyopathy, malignant arrhythmias. Unstable angina, MI, CHF (NYHA ≥Class 2), or vascular disease requiring hospitalization within 12 months before first dose; other cardiac impairments affecting drug safety assessment. Severe ulcers, unhealed wounds, GI perforation, fistula, obstruction, abscess, or acute GI bleeding within 6 months before first dose; thromboembolic events, TIA, stroke within 6 months before first dose; COPD exacerbation, hypertensive crisis/encephalopathy within 1 month before first dose; current hypertension uncontrolled by oral medication (systolic BP more than 150 mmHg or diastolic BP more than 90 mmHg).
  • History or current non-infectious pneumonia/interstitial lung disease requiring systemic corticosteroids; active or past definite inflammatory bowel disease (e.g., Crohn's disease, ulcerative colitis, chronic diarrhea); active autoimmune disease requiring systemic treatment within past 2 years (e.g., DMARDs, corticosteroids, immunosuppressants). Replacement therapy (e.g., thyroid hormones, insulin, physiological corticosteroids for adrenal/pituitary insufficiency) is not considered systemic treatment.
  • History of immunodeficiency; positive HIV antibody test; current long-term use of systemic corticosteroids or other immunosuppressants (except short-term corticosteroids for COPD-related dyspnea or temporary allergy prevention).
  • Known active tuberculosis (TB); suspected active TB requires clinical exclusion; known active syphilis infection.
  • Severe infection within 4 weeks before first dose (e.g., requiring hospitalization, sepsis, severe pneumonia); active infection treated with systemic anti-infectives within 2 weeks before first dose (excluding antiviral therapy for hepatitis B/C).
  • Past systemic chemotherapy or bevacizumab/biosimilar treatment.
  • Past immunotherapy, including immune checkpoint inhibitors (e.g., anti-PD-1/L1, CTLA-4, CD47, SIRPα, LAG-3 antibodies), immune checkpoint agonists (e.g., ICOS, CD40, CD137, GITR, OX40 antibodies), or any immunotherapy targeting tumor immune mechanisms.
  • Past local therapy for liver lesions, including TACE, TARE, HAIC, or radiotherapy.
  • Systemic anti-tumor traditional Chinese medicine or immunomodulatory drugs (e.g., thymosin, interferon, interleukin) within 2 weeks before first dose (except those locally used to control pleural/ascitic fluid).
  • Live/attenuated vaccine administration within 30 days before first dose or planned during study; inactivated vaccines are allowed.
  • Known allergy to any study drug component; history of severe hypersensitivity to other monoclonal antibodies.
  • Known psychiatric disease, drug abuse, alcoholism, or substance addiction.
  • Pregnant or breastfeeding women.
  • Any condition, disease, or abnormality that may interfere with study results, hinder study participation, or pose additional risk, as determined by the investigator.

结局指标

主要结局

Progression-free survival (PFS)

时间窗: Up to 1 years

Progression-free survival is defined as the time from the start of treatment with AK112 until the first documentation of disease progression or death due to any cause, whichever occurs first.
